Safety Personnel

Safety underpins everything we do at Perfect Remediation & Refurbishment - and given how often our work happens at height, in confined spaces or on live infrastructure, our safety team carries real weight.

Our safety personnel oversee every stage of a project, from the initial access and risk assessment through to sign-off, making sure protocols hold up in environments that don’t leave much room for error. The goal is straightforward: everyone goes home safely, every day.

Roles on our safety team include:
  • Certified Safety Officers
    Build and roll out site-specific safety plans, run regular audits, and keep every project compliant with current WHS regulations – with particular attention to height access and confined space work.
  • Site Safety Coordinators
    On the ground daily, making sure PPE, fall protection and respiratory equipment are used correctly, and running toolbox talks that address the specific risks of that day’s work.
  • Compliance & Risk Management Officers
    Track WHS legislative changes, assess risk on a project-by-project basis, and build mitigation strategies suited to the technical demands of remediation work.

Beyond their daily responsibilities, our safety personnel also lead ongoing training sessions so our crews stay prepared for whatever a site throws at them – this proactive approach is what keeps safety embedded across the business rather than something reviewed after the fact.

Meet our safety team:

Roxana Roszkowska

Roxana is a Work Health and Safety professional with more than 10 years’ experience in construction.

She holds a Diploma of WHS along with a range of industry qualifications, and focuses on building and improving the safety management systems used across the Perfect Group.

Her work on legislative compliance has been central to keeping complex, high-risk sites safe.

As WHS coordinator across the Group, she provides support and guidance to make sure safety standards are applied consistently everywhere Perfect operates – including here at PRR.

Michael Dall

Michael has spent more than 50 years in the construction industry across trade services and safety roles, including 25 years with SafeWork/WorkCover as a construction safety inspector.

He’s managed major regulatory projects and led numerous incident investigations, including work resulting in prosecutions for WHS breaches. He holds a Bachelor of OH&S from Newcastle University along with two diplomas and an advanced diploma in safety management, and has lectured at Newcastle University on risk management, incident investigation and construction safety. He’s worked with Tier 1 contractors across the industry to build safety partnerships that hold up under real operational pressure – including one project that logged two million hours worked without a lost-time injury.
